1969 Chevrolet Camaro Description

This Camaro is very unique from all the rest. It has a fiberglass tilt front end and also the rear spoiler has been fiber glassed into the trunk lid. I am the second owner of the car. The first owner was a GM engineer who bought it brand new off of the assembly line and owned it for 48 years and then sold it to me. He was a fiber glass junkie and liked to make things unique from all the rest. The car is very solid and has no squeks or rattles. The original engine was rebuilt 5000 miles ago and runs perfectly. Also a new clutch and pressure plate was installed at that time. I also had a new competition plus Hurst shifter installed also. It runs and shifts perfectly. The engine is bored .060 over and has flat top pistons to accomodate ethenol fuel used today and runs great on pump gas. The paint shines very well but is not show quality. It is a driver and is turn key. The car draws a lot of attention whenever I take it out, It runs well and is a lot of fun to drive. The interior kit was installed recently with new head liner, carpet, seats and dash. All the gauges work on the car.
